Transaction 225519271006aa1b140eff76cf8f3a97067cf89fba1c4419a5ef1b8bd4b9d7c4
1 Input
1 Output
-
225519271006aa1b140eff76cf8f3a97067cf89fba1c4419a5ef1b8bd4b9d7c4:0
- value
- 999427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b2025d7518bdc7d27b0fc8171f20ee6ac3d0030 OP_EQUAL
- address
- 3JkSo5uuUgGkfPvwc8nxUx4kVQLRoLx6af